Hi There,

I am using the wordpress plugin, which is great and got it all working how i want now.  A major problem is the use of H1 and H2 tags in the pop,  as this will affect the SEO of my website.  There should only be one H1 tag on a page, how can we remove these?

Hi James,

Thanks for bringing this to our attention. In short, HTML5 allows multiple H1 headings, so there is nothing really to worry about in terms of SEO.

That said, we've changed it from using H1 and H2 tags; to using H2 and H3 tags within its own section element.

If your curious about learning more, Google Webmasters released this delightful video on the topic: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=WsgrSxCmMbM

No, you don't need to worry about that.

The plugin makes it easier for you to set your configuration, but the main javascript that cookie control depends on is loaded from our CDN; so you will already have the latest version.
